Damian Crowther

Entrepreneur in Residence, Life Sciences at Oxford Sciences Innovation

Damian joined OSI in January 2021 as an Entrepreneur in Residence. He was previously Director, R&D and Head of Early Drug Discovery for Neuroscience at AstraZeneca Biopharmaceuticals. Prior to that he pursued a clinician-scientist role in neurodegeneration, combining training in neurology at Addenbrookes hospital with basic research at the Department of Genetics and affiliated to the Cambridge Institute for Medical Research. Damian continues to lecture at the University of Cambridge and UCL where he is an Honorary Associate Professor. He is also a founder of GPnotebook.co.uk, the UK’s premier professional medical reference resource, and pursued project spin-outs while at AstraZeneca. At OSI, Damian will provide in-house neuroscience consultancy and expertise, and aims to identify credible scientific breakthroughs to form the basis of an innovative new portfolio company.
